MotoGP 24: A Strategic Drive Into New Frontiers The release of marks a significant evolution for the long-running motorcycle racing series, introducing features that emphasize a more dynamic, unpredictable, and fair "gamedrive" experience . Whether you're a seasoned veteran or a newcomer, the 2024 installment from Milestone brings pivotal changes to the career mode, AI behavior, and race regulations that reshape how you interact with the sport. Traditional simulations use look-up tables for tire grip. GameDrive proposes a recurrent neural network (RNN) trained on 2023–2024 MotoGP sensor data (temperature, pressure, wear, track surface). This model predicts grip decay and peak slip angles in real time, varying per corner.
